If you need to make sure your data and privacy are not affected by unexpected VPN dropouts, VPNKS can provide the necessary protection.
After you have installed the application and you've made sure you have at least one VPN active. When started, VPNKS will try to detect your connection. If your VPN is up, a green message will be displayed as "VPN Detected!". This way you can make sure your connection works. When you deactivate or lose the connection, the message will turn yellow; "VPN is down."
The interface also includes the "Config" tab where you can manage your preferences and programs, the "Exit" tab which closes the tool and "About", where you can find information about the version, developer, and a small "readme" field.
VPNKS will instantly detect your VPN connection right from the startup, which is a big plus as there are no waiting time or slow booting. The termination of processes is also done very quickly, the risk of data leakage being heavily reduced.
While active, the tool will be visible in the system tray and will monitor your connection status from the background. From "Config" you can check the "Start with windows" box to make you are protected at OS startup.
In order to facilitate a strong and secure environment, the app sports a number of kill switches. "Program termination" kills all listed programs when the VPN is down; "Connection Block" stops all listed programs' inbound and outbound connections; "Overkill Switch" blocks all the connections and closes all programs.
"Process protection" is another useful feature that won't allow any program to start up if the VPN is not connected. Also, you can opt for shutting down the PC if the connection drops.
In conclusion, if you are a daily VPN user and want to make sure that your privacy is not compromised and your data is safeguarded, VPN Kill Switch will take care of your connection status. Being very responsive, this tool will shut down your programs in no time to ensure adequate protection. All types of users can operate the app as VPNKS is mostly automatic.
Chrome and Firefox extensions are also available for users who want to block access to specific websites on VPN connection drops.
